Once you find the amount incorrectly posted to Opening Balance Equity, you’ll need to figure out where it should have been posted. This could be either a revenue or expense category, an asset account, a liability account, or a different equity account. You might need a professional bookkeeper to help you do this. The best way to fix or eliminate Opening Balance Equity virtual accountant is to make a journal entry transferring the amount to the proper accounts. If you’re unfamiliar with debits and credits and journal entries, you might need the help of a bookkeeper; see our guide on what a bookkeeper does.

Leaving a balance in Opening Balance Equity is problematic because it indicates that the opening balances for certain accounts were not allocated correctly. In accounting, equity represents the ownership value in the business, and failing to resolve Opening Balance Equity could lead to inaccurate financial statements. Opening Balance Equity is an account created by QuickBooks to offset any beginning balances entered in the chart of accounts. You can avoid an Open Balance Equity account by ensuring the equality of debits and credits of your beginning balances. If not, then QuickBooks will plug the difference to Opening Balance Equity.

If you’ve ever set up a new company in QuickBooks Online (QBO), you may have come across the Opening Balance Equity (OBE) account. It’s a special type of account created to help balance your books when entering opening balances for various accounts such as bank accounts, loans, or credit cards. This isn’t a major issue because it doesn’t affect opening balance equity income and expense, but you should transfer this amount to a properly titled equity account, like Paid-in Capital, using a journal entry.
